  2. A military reserve, active reserve, reserve formation, or simply reserve, is a group of military personnel or units that is initially not committed to a battle by its commander, so that it remains available to address unforeseen situations or exploit sudden opportunities.
    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Military_reserve

    The military reserves are components of the active-duty military service branches. Unlike the National Guard, the reserves are always funded by the federal government. The reserve is meant to augment the needs of the active duty force in times of conflict or declared war.

    What is a military reserve?The military reserves are components of the active-duty military service branches. Unlike the National Guard, the reserves are always funded by the federal government. The reserve is meant to augment the needs of the active duty force in times of conflict or declared war.
    What is a reservist in the Army?Reservists can also be civilians who undertake basic and specialized training in parallel with regular forces while retaining their civilian roles. They can be deployed independently, or their personnel may make up shortages in regular units. Ireland's Army Reserve is an example of such a reserve.
    What is the purpose of the Army Reserve?The purpose of the Reserve is to provide and maintain trained units and qualified persons to be available for active duty in the armed forces when needed. This may be in times of war, in a national emergency, or as the need occurs based on threats to national security. Their presence can be called upon to serve either stateside or overseas.
    What are the Armed Forces Reserve Components?The Reserve Components of the United States Armed forces are named within Title 10 of the United States Code and include: (1) the Army National Guard, (2) the Army Reserve, (3) the Navy Reserve, (4) the Marine Corps Reserve, (5) the Air National Guard, (6) the Air Force Reserve, and (7) the Coast Guard Reserve.
